Vue DyUI是一款基于Vue.js的UI組件庫,它由一系列精心設(shè)計的組件和布局提供商用級的用戶界面,以協(xié)助前端開發(fā)人員迅速構(gòu)建交互性、可維護(hù)和易于使用的Web應(yīng)用程序。而且Vue DyUI完全開源,我們可以在GitHub上找到其源代碼,并對其做出更新和改進(jìn)。
Vue DyUI提供了豐富的UI組件,包括按鈕、表格、表單、富文本編輯器、日歷、提示框等等。這些組件大大減少了前端開發(fā)人員的開發(fā)時間和開發(fā)難度,可以幫助我們專注于業(yè)務(wù)邏輯的實現(xiàn)。
<template>
<div class="container">
<dy-button type="primary">確認(rèn)</dy-button>
<dy-button type="danger">取消</dy-button>
<dy-checkbox-group v-model="checkedNames">
<dy-checkbox label="Jack"></dy-checkbox>
<dy-checkbox label="Lucy"></dy-checkbox>
<dy-checkbox label="Tom"></dy-checkbox>
</dy-checkbox-group>
</div>
</template>
<script>
import { DyButton, DyCheckbox, DyCheckboxGroup } from 'vue-dyui';
export default {
components: {
DyButton,
DyCheckbox,
DyCheckboxGroup
},
data() {
return {
checkedNames: []
};
}
};
</script>
上面這段示例代碼是Vue DyUI中常用組件的使用方法。我們可以看到,只需要在Vue的template中引入組件(如DyButton、DyCheckbox、DyCheckboxGroup),就可以使用這些組件的全部功能。同時,我們也可以在組件中使用v-model綁定數(shù)據(jù)。
總之,Vue DyUI為我們提供了一系列易用、優(yōu)雅、高效的UI組件,大大提高了我們前端開發(fā)的效率,是我們開發(fā)Web應(yīng)用程序時可以更好地展現(xiàn)出自己的才華。
上一篇vue dwg